Not sure if you can see it in the pics but the center stack was held in with clips vs. the two screws at the top, per the video and the a/c ducts have male fasteners stick up from the bottom which secures a wire cluster beneath the ducts. However, I examined a 301A same year and it appears to be the same as the video so again, the 2025 with the 400A package seems to be a bit different but the video claims to be accurate for ALL Mustangs. 2024+ so I’m a bit lost and frustrated…

You still have to remove the two screws (one of which you are pointing to with your screwdriver in the first photo) holding the A/C ducting (behind the vents), and pull the duct out, to access the wire connector that the perimeter plus wiring hooks to.
